Ready to jump into a world of excitement? Look no further than Slot888, your portal to massive wins. With a treasure trove of slots to choose from, you're sure to find your ideal match. Twist the reels and watch as the pictures align, bringing you closer to that incredible jackpot! Launch your favorite games anytime, anywhere with our user-fri